I received a following question from our customer about li-ion USB battery of Group series Remote Control.

Question:
The customer always leave the USB battery charging while not in use.
Is there any concerns caused by overcharging? or no problem?

Absolutly not necessary.  The battery will go a long time, months, of average use, on a charge.  You are alerted ahead of time when the battery is low.  Even if it goes dead you can charge if for a couple of minutes and it will be good for 30-50 button pushes.

 

IF you recharge the battery once a month it will still recharge to 85% of its original capacity after about 300 charges (about 25 years).  It can be recharged about 1000 times before not being able to hold a charge. 

 

Under what we consider normal usage the battery should need to be recharged every 2.5 - 3 months.  At this recharge level the battery should maintain full charging capacity for over 7 years.

 

  • After 300 recharge cycles, the battery pack will charge to approximately 85% of its original capacity.
  • After 500 recharge cycles, the battery pack will charge to approximately 70% of its original capacity.

 

From the GS Admin Guide:

The low battery notification returns after you dismiss other notifications, and is not displayed while the system is in a call.
